Layout version 1.0 adds significant functionality not recognized by systems
supporting only version 0.8, including:
— Category class objects (formerly the category and category_title attributes
within the bundle or product class).
— Patch-handling attributes, including applied_patches, is_patch, and
patch_state.
— The fileset architecture attribute at the fileset level, which permits you to
specify the architecture of the target system on which the software will run.
In addition to adding new attributes and objects, layout version 1.0 changes the
following preexisting 0.8 objects and attributes:
— Replaces the depot media_sequence_number attribute for the media object
with a sequence number attribute.
— Replaces the vendor definition within products and bundles with a
vendor_tag attribute and a corresponding vendor object defined outside the
product or bundle.
— Pluralizes the corequisite and prerequisite fileset attributes.
— Changes the timestamp attribute to mod_time.

• level=
Specifies a software level for swacl, swlist and swreg.
For swlist, this option lists all objects down to the specified level. Both the
specified levels and the depth of the specified software_selections control
the depth of the swlist output. The supported software levels are:
— bundle -- show all objects down to the bundle level.
— product -- show all objects down to the product level. Also use -lbundle
-l productto show bundles.
— subproduct -- show all objects down to the subproduct level.
— fileset -- show all objects down to the fileset level. Also use -l fileset -l
subproduct to show subproducts.
— file -- show all objects down to the file level (depots, products, filesets, and
files).
— control_file -- show all objects down to the control_file level.
— category -- show all categories of available software objects.
— patch -- show all applied patches. (See also the show_superseded_patches
option.)
The supported depot and root levels are:
— depot -- show only the depot level (depots that exist at the specified target
hosts.)
— root -- list all alternate roots.
— shroot -- list all registered shared roots (HP-UX 10.X only).
— prroot -- list all private roots (HP-UX 10.X only).
